Therapeutic Games and Guided Imagery is packed with tools for social workers counselors school professionals students and other helping professionals in the medical and mental health fields. The exercises included are both innovative and empirically tested; they aim to help clients increase the benefits of psychotherapy within a relatively short time. Professor Cheung has structured the books with tables and a cross-referenced index to facilitate easy and efficient navigation of the many step-by-step activities and exercises. The interactive exercises contained in Volume II are designed for children and adolescents with specific needs and in multicultural settings. Based on literature supporting the use of games and guided imagery for children with specific needs the materials included provide a basis for innovative and creative engagement with children and families enabling diverse solutions for diverse needs. The volume also includes a number of multilingual exercises and several examples of the guided imagery available at the associated website.
